Treatment for linear fibrosis typically focuses on addressing the underlying cause and alleviating symptoms. Management may include physical therapy to improve mobility, corticosteroid injections to reduce inflammation, and topical treatments for skin lesions. In some cases, surgical intervention may be necessary to remove fibrotic tissue. It's essential for individuals to work with a healthcare provider to determine the most appropriate treatment plan based on their specific condition and needs.

What is fibrosis linear densities?

Fibrosis linear densities refer to areas of increased density observed in imaging studies, such as X-rays or CT scans, indicating the presence of fibrotic tissue in the lungs or other organs. This fibrotic tissue results from chronic inflammation and scarring, often associated with various diseases, including interstitial lung disease and pulmonary fibrosis. The linear densities can reflect the extent and pattern of fibrotic changes, helping clinicians assess disease severity and guide treatment decisions.
